Ackard Land Co in Denver

Ackard Land Co

950 Lafayette St
80218
Denver, CO
(303) 860-0332
Write your review of Ackard Land Co
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
898 ft
Webb, Duane
1137 E 10th Ave
Denver, CO 80218
0.2 mi
Web Savvy Real Estate
1023 E 9th Ave
Denver, CO 80218
0.2 mi
Foster, Simon M
1023 E 9th Ave
Denver, CO 80218
0.2 mi
Denver Real Estate Group
1023 E 9th Ave
Denver, CO 80218
0.3 mi
JG Management & Business Properties Inc
1029 E 8th Ave Suite 1107
Denver, CO 80218
0.3 mi
Real Space Commercial Real Estate
1250 Humboldt St # 901
Denver, CO 80218